Separate single-page JS tracker

From Free Software Directory
< Free Software Directory:Issues
Revision as of 18:15, 22 January 2022 by Adfeno (talk | contribs)

(diff) ← Older revision | Approved revision (diff) | Latest revision (diff) | Newer revision → (diff)
Jump to: navigation, search


Issue assigned to: User:Adfeno.

Is top priority issue? true.

See Free Software Directory:Single-page JS tracker for a test case.

In order to preserve the history of our bug/issue tracker, and the valuable contributions from User:LorenzoAncora, we should separate the single-page tracker adequately.

Most of the Backlog Admin Group members agreed that we must do the following items:

  1. Move User:LorenzoAncora's contributions to MediaWiki:Common.js, related to the single-page issue tracker, to a separate JavaScript so that they can adequately attribute copyright to their work.
  2. Find whether it's possible to do the same as 1 but for the CSS.
  3. Find a way to target both 1 and 2 to be used only when loading FSD:Backlog active and FSD:Backlog archive.
  4. Move the following pages: Template:BacklogIssue, Template:BacklogIssue/HTMLid, Template:TopPriorityBacklogIssue, Template:BacklogIssue/stalledBy.

Resolution

All tasks done.



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free Documentation License, Version 1.3 or any later version published by the Free Software Foundation; with no Invariant Sections, no Front-Cover Texts, and no Back-Cover Texts. A copy of the license is included in the page “GNU Free Documentation License”.

The copyright and license notices on this page only apply to the text on this page. Any software or copyright-licenses or other similar notices described in this text has its own copyright notice and license, which can usually be found in the distribution or license text itself.